What is one function of the hyphen?

Answer:

One function of the hyphen is to connect two words acting as a single unit to modify a noun.

Explanation:

The correct way to use a <em>hyphen (-)</em> is to separate the two words that make up a <u>compound word.</u>

Its function is to join these types of words:

  • Compound nouns. For example: <em>stick-in-the-mud</em> .
  • Compound verbs. For example:<em> to gift-wrap .</em>
  • Compound adjectives. For example: <em>state-of-the-art .</em>

It is very important <u>not to confuse hyphens with dashes.</u> Dashes are much longer (-), while hyphens are shorter (-).

Another feature is that <u>spaces should not be used when writing hyphens. </u>
